Vietnam'S Tariffs On 99% Of The EU Free Trade Agreement Will Be Abolished Or Reduced.

Vietnam approved the free trade agreement with the European Union on Monday, which will cut or cancel 99% tariffs on trade in goods and provide an urgent boost for Vietnam's post epidemic economy. The agreement is expected to take effect in July. It is a free-trade agreement between the European Union and another ASEAN member after Singapore. The agreement will also open Vietnam's service industry to the EU, including postal, banking, shipping and public procurement markets.
